Finally, the much-awaited album of Swifties has just released yesterday, October 22, 2012. but is it worth the wait?

Taylor’s new album drew a lot of speculation of stepping out of the style sooner or later she established a few years later and try something new to prolong her colorful life as a singer.

her fourth new album has the genre of country music with the touch of Pop-rock. it is obvious in its first track, State of Grace, the Arena rock song which has the U2 and the Cranberries influenced. Swift did put strong lines in chorus such as “This is the state of grace/this is the worth while fight/Love is a ruthless game/unless you play it good and right”.

while, Treacherous has the sexiest and smoothest melody in the album which is one of the highlights of RED. 

Swift, has collaborated with various Folk-rock artists (this is after writing the song Safe and Sound with The Civil Wars) such as Ed Sheeran- “everything has Changed”, this song will receive a musical praise for Ed and Swift for they had made a great piece. next, is “The Last Time” with Gary Lightbody’s voice, another two points for the album.

Max Martin and Shelback also Co-wrote with three songs of the album,such as : “We are Never Ever Getting Back Together” which made to the top of Billboard for weeks, and compared her to Avril Lavigne’s way of singing, “I Knew You Were Trouble” the dubstep song that Made to no. 3 in Billboard and the song “22”. points for the album.

Swift and Liz rose- the one who co-wrote the grammy winning and nominating pieces- You Belong with Me and White Horse, reunited with the song “All too Well.

she also wrote song with Dan Wilson with Treacherous.. and the rest of the songs were written by Taylor.

 

Over-all, though Swift is just steps away her original genre, we’re pretty sure that this album is another award-winning piece of taylor. though, It is most of heartbreak songs..

16 Songs of Taylor Swift You Should Listen

Everyone knows about country-pop crooner taylor swift whose an indeed world phenomenon. From her hair, eyes, lips to her boots, from her sparkly dresses down to her sparkly guitar, her ex-boyfriends, and also you know all of her songs. And now, speaking of her songs, I give you the list of her 16 songs you should not miss to listen to.

Image 16. The Best Day/ Never Grow Up Writer/s: Taylor Swift Taylor is known of her being vocal about her love life in form of songs. But with these, she never did forget to write songs for her family specifically, for her mom. The best day is from the album Fearless. In this song, Swift tells the story of their mom-daughter relationship. How her mom saves her from sadness, and how she saves her from mean girls. Next, Never Grow UP from the album Speak Now , in this song, you can feel that Swift went through sadness after she got her own kitchen. In the lyrics, she said that she wished she never grew up so she would not have to separate home.

            From the album Speak now.  Basically, this two-time Grammy winner song (best country song and best country solo performance in 2012) wrote to prove something to her critics about she can’t sing. This song was allegedly written after her controversial “off-tune performance of Rhiannon” in 2010 Grammy awards with stevie nicks.

6. White Horse

writer/s: Taylor Swift, Liz Rose

           Image     From Fearless album. This song was about the fail-fairy tale love story of her after her prince charming cheated her. This song gave Swift two Grammy awards in 2010- Best Country song and Best Country female Vocal Performance.
